Age | Commit message (Expand) | Author | Files | Lines |
2022-04-22 | binfmt_flat: Remove shared library support | Eric W. Biederman | 1 | -150/+40 |
2022-04-20 | binfmt_flat: Drop vestiges of coredump support | Eric W. Biederman | 1 | -22/+0 |
2022-04-19 | binfmt_flat: do not stop relocating GOT entries prematurely on riscv | Niklas Cassel | 1 | -1/+26 |
2022-03-09 | coredump: Don't compile flat_core_dump when coredumps are disabled | Eric W. Biederman | 1 | -0/+4 |
2022-03-08 | coredump: Move definition of struct coredump_params into coredump.h | Eric W. Biederman | 1 | -0/+1 |
2022-03-02 | binfmt: move more stuff undef CONFIG_COREDUMP | Alexey Dobriyan | 1 | -0/+2 |
2021-06-29 | binfmt: remove in-tree usage of MAP_EXECUTABLE | David Hildenbrand | 1 | -1/+1 |
2021-04-19 | binfmt_flat: allow not offsetting data start | Damien Le Moal | 1 | -5/+13 |
2020-08-24 | binfmt_flat: revert "binfmt_flat: don't offset the data start" | Max Filippov | 1 | -8/+12 |
2020-06-11 | Merge branch 'uaccess.misc' of git://git.kernel.org/pub/scm/linux/kernel/git/... | Linus Torvalds | 1 | -8/+14 |
2020-06-08 | binfmt_flat: use flush_icache_user_range | Christoph Hellwig | 1 | -1/+1 |
2020-06-03 | binfmt_flat: don't use __put_user() | Al Viro | 1 | -8/+14 |
2020-05-08 | exec: Rename flush_old_exec begin_new_exec | Eric W. Biederman | 1 | -1/+1 |
2020-05-08 | exec: Merge install_exec_creds into setup_new_exec | Eric W. Biederman | 1 | -1/+0 |
2020-05-08 | binfmt: Move install_exec_creds after setup_new_exec to match binfmt_elf | Eric W. Biederman | 1 | -2/+1 |
2019-07-17 | fs/binfmt_flat.c: remove set but not used variable 'inode' | YueHaibing | 1 | -2/+0 |
2019-07-11 | Merge branch 'for-next' of git://git.kernel.org/pub/scm/linux/kernel/git/gerg... | Linus Torvalds | 1 | -37/+62 |
2019-06-29 | fs/binfmt_flat.c: make load_flat_shared_library() work | Jann Horn | 1 | -16/+7 |
2019-06-24 | binfmt_flat: don't offset the data start | Christoph Hellwig | 1 | -12/+8 |
2019-06-24 | binfmt_flat: move the MAX_SHARED_LIBS definition to binfmt_flat.c | Christoph Hellwig | 1 | -0/+6 |
2019-06-24 | binfmt_flat: remove the persistent argument from flat_get_addr_from_rp | Christoph Hellwig | 1 | -3/+1 |
2019-06-24 | binfmt_flat: make support for old format binaries optional | Christoph Hellwig | 1 | -8/+22 |
2019-06-24 | binfmt_flat: add endianess annotations | Christoph Hellwig | 1 | -10/+16 |
2019-06-24 | binfmt_flat: remove the uapi <linux/flat.h> header | Christoph Hellwig | 1 | -0/+1 |
2019-06-24 | binfmt_flat: replace flat_argvp_envp_on_stack with a Kconfig variable | Christoph Hellwig | 1 | -2/+3 |
2019-06-24 | binfmt_flat: remove flat_old_ram_flag | Christoph Hellwig | 1 | -1/+2 |
2019-06-24 | binfmt_flat: provide a default version of flat_get_relocate_addr | Christoph Hellwig | 1 | -0/+4 |
2019-06-24 | binfmt_flat: remove flat_set_persistent | Christoph Hellwig | 1 | -2/+0 |
2019-06-24 | binfmt_flat: remove flat_reloc_valid | Christoph Hellwig | 1 | -1/+1 |
2018-04-11 | exec: introduce finalize_exec() before start_thread() | Kees Cook | 1 | -0/+1 |
2017-11-02 | License cleanup: add SPDX GPL-2.0 license identifier to files with no license | Greg Kroah-Hartman | 1 | -0/+1 |
2017-09-15 | Merge branch 'work.set_fs' of git://git.kernel.org/pub/scm/linux/kernel/git/v... | Linus Torvalds | 1 | -13/+5 |
2017-09-09 | binfmt_flat: delete two error messages for a failed memory allocation in deco... | Markus Elfring | 1 | -5/+3 |
2017-09-05 | fs: fix kernel_read prototype | Christoph Hellwig | 1 | -13/+5 |
2017-08-01 | exec: Rename bprm->cred_prepared to called_set_creds | Kees Cook | 1 | -1/+1 |
2017-07-16 | binfmt_flat: Use %u to format u32 | Geert Uytterhoeven | 1 | -1/+1 |
2017-07-04 | binfmt_flat: flat_{get,put}_addr_from_rp() should be able to fail | Al Viro | 1 | -17/+22 |
2017-03-02 | sched/headers: Prepare for new header dependencies before moving code to <lin... | Ingo Molnar | 1 | -0/+1 |
2016-07-28 | binfmt_flat: allow compressed flat binary format to work on MMU systems | Nicolas Pitre | 1 | -2/+42 |
2016-07-28 | binfmt_flat: add MMU-specific support | Nicolas Pitre | 1 | -3/+13 |
2016-07-28 | binfmt_flat: update libraries' data segment pointer with userspace accessors | Nicolas Pitre | 1 | -6/+13 |
2016-07-28 | binfmt_flat: use clear_user() rather than memset() to clear .bss | Nicolas Pitre | 1 | -4/+5 |
2016-07-28 | binfmt_flat: use proper user space accessors with old relocs code | Nicolas Pitre | 1 | -10/+18 |
2016-07-25 | binfmt_flat: use proper user space accessors with relocs processing code | Nicolas Pitre | 1 | -12/+19 |
2016-07-25 | binfmt_flat: clean up create_flat_tables() and stack accesses | Nicolas Pitre | 1 | -54/+63 |
2016-07-25 | binfmt_flat: use generic transfer_args_to_stack() | Nicolas Pitre | 1 | -12/+10 |
2016-07-25 | binfmt_flat: prevent kernel dammage from corrupted executable headers | Nicolas Pitre | 1 | -0/+11 |
2016-07-25 | binfmt_flat: convert printk invocations to their modern form | Nicolas Pitre | 1 | -67/+51 |
2016-07-25 | binfmt_flat: assorted cleanups | Nicolas Pitre | 1 | -121/+109 |
2016-05-28 | remove lots of IS_ERR_VALUE abuses | Arnd Bergmann | 1 | -3/+3 |